This Wikipedia page shows that the worst days by percentage are not where we are yet.
However… Rank, President (AFFILIATION), date, DJ, Point loss, %loss
1 Reagan ®, 1987-10-19, 1738.74, −508.00, −22.61%
2 Trump ®, 2020-03-16, 20188.52, −2997.10, −12.93%
3 Hoover ®, 1929-10-28, 260.64, −38.33, −12.82%
4 Hoover ®, 1929-10-29, 230.07, −30.57, −11.73%
5 Trump ®, 2020-03-12, 21200.62, −2352.60, −9.99%
6 Hoover ®, 1929-11-06, 232.13, −25.55, −9.92%
7 McKinley ®, 1899-12-18, 58.27, −5.57, −8.72%
8 Hoover ®, 1932-08-12, 63.11, −5.79, −8.40%
9 T. Roosevelt ®, 1907-03-14, 76.23, −6.89, −8.29%
10 Reagan ®, 1987-10-26, 1793.93, −156.83 , −8.04 %
All republicans. I note that the biggest daily gains were also republicans but most of them are related to the big drops e.g a day, week or month later, so they basically tank the index then the index recovers some time later.
